Why You Should Watch

Babies not only discover new things every day, but they also constantly rediscover things they’ve already been introduced to. Seeing for yourself how a baby interacts with, for example, a rattle or mobile, is to gain a deeper understanding of the workings of your child’s development, particularly their short-term memory development. This insight helps you stimulate their learning in ways that helps their powers of recognition develop, but not so much that you push them too far before they’re ready.
